Steve Marriner is a Canadian multi-instrumentalist, singer, songwriter and record producer.
Since 2008, he has been the frontman, singer, one of two guitarists and harmonica player for the Juno Award winning Canadian rock'n'roll-blues group MonkeyJunk.
Marriner’s prolific and respected talent has led to collaborations and tours with numerous artists, including Harry Manx, Colin James, Blue Rodeo, Jimmie Vaughan and Buddy Guy.
